在Android开发中,约束布局(ConstraintLayout)是一种强大而灵活的布局方式,可以通过约束关系来定义组件之间的位置和尺寸。同时,约束布局还支持动画效果,通过动态改变约束关系,可以实现各种吸引人的界面交互效果。本文将介绍如何使用约束布局和动画来创建动态布局效果,并提供相应的源代码。
首先,我们需要创建一个基本的约束布局,并添加一些组件。以下是一个简单的示例布局:
<?xml version="1.0" encoding="utf-8"?>
<androidx.constraintlayout.widget.ConstraintLayout xmlns:android="http://sc